| /** |
| * Instances of the class {@code MethodMember} represent a method element defined in a parameterized |
| * type where the values of the type parameters are known. |
| */ |
| public class MethodMember extends ExecutableMember implements MethodElement { |
| /** |
| * If the given method's type is different when any type parameters from the defining type's |
| * declaration are replaced with the actual type arguments from the defining type, create a method |
| * member representing the given method. Return the member that was created, or the base method if |
| * no member was created. |
| * |
| * @param baseMethod the base method for which a member might be created |
| * @param definingType the type defining the parameters and arguments to be used in the |
| * substitution |
| * @return the method element that will return the correctly substituted types |
| */ |
| public static MethodElement from(MethodElement baseMethod, InterfaceType definingType) { |
| if (baseMethod == null || definingType.getTypeArguments().length == 0) { |
| return baseMethod; |
| } |
| FunctionType baseType = baseMethod.getType(); |
| Type[] argumentTypes = definingType.getTypeArguments(); |
| Type[] parameterTypes = definingType.getElement().getType().getTypeArguments(); |
| FunctionType substitutedType = baseType.substitute(argumentTypes, parameterTypes); |
| if (baseType.equals(substitutedType)) { |
| return baseMethod; |
| } |
| // TODO(brianwilkerson) Consider caching the substituted type in the instance. It would use more |
| // memory but speed up some operations. We need to see how often the type is being re-computed. |
| return new MethodMember(baseMethod, definingType); |
| } |
